OAK LAWN, Ill. — The stage is set at the Oak Lawn Public Library (9427 Raymond Ave.) for the highly anticipated second annual adult Spelling Bee, slated for Saturday, Oct. 7. Contenders, both veteran and novice, will face off starting 2 p.m., battling word-for-word, many drawn from the esteemed Scripps National Spelling Bee list.

Those wishing to throw their hat into the ring must first pass a qualifying quiz between 1 and 1:30 p.m. the same day. The top 20 scorers advance to the main event. The community is encouraged to contribute word suggestions online or at the library’s Adult Services desk.

Programming Librarian Kate Donley recalls last year’s intense competition, noting participants aimed to conquer past spelling traumas. This year’s winner will earn not just bragging rights but also a dazzling champion’s crown or tiara.
